Web23 sep. 2024 · Is 6 mph fast on a treadmill? For most people 2 to 4 mph is a walking speed; 4 to 5 mph is a very fast walk or jog; and anything over 5 mph is jogging or running. Walking: 3-4 miles per hour Jogging: 6 mph Running: 8 mph or faster There is no one “best” speed for walking, jogging, or running.The best way to find the ideal speed for walking, jogging, or running is to experiment and see what feels comfortable for you.
